How they compare

Bahamas currently reports 5.52 billion current US$ against 5.07 billion current US$ in Rwanda, a difference of 450.00 million current US$.

That makes Bahamas's figure about 1.1 times Rwanda's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Bahamas ahead.

Bahamas ranks 137th and Rwanda ranks 139th of 206 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Bahamas averaged higher in 6 and Rwanda in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Bahamas Rwanda Difference Ahead
1960s 127.80 million current US$ 16.60 million current US$ 111.20 million current US$ Bahamas
1970s 2.01 billion current US$ 89.70 million current US$ 1.92 billion current US$ Bahamas
1980s 4.48 billion current US$ 307.10 million current US$ 4.17 billion current US$ Bahamas
1990s 1.30 billion current US$ 277.90 million current US$ 1.03 billion current US$ Bahamas
2000s 2.42 billion current US$ 559.80 million current US$ 1.86 billion current US$ Bahamas
2010s 3.35 billion current US$ 2.32 billion current US$ 1.03 billion current US$ Bahamas
2020s 4.03 billion current US$ 4.62 billion current US$ 592.67 million current US$ Rwanda

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Merchandise imports includes goods whose economic ownership is changed from a non-resident to a resident and that are not included in the following specific categories: goods under merchanting, non-monetary gold, and parts of travel, construction, and government goods and services n.i.e.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
